SHAC Announces Another Victory
Close Huntingdon Life ScienceSHAC USA is pleased to announce yet another victory in the campaign against HLS clients. Toxweb, a biotech software company out of California, has issued a statement that they are no longer affiliated with HLS in any way.
Check out the brief, and enormously effective, campaign against Toxweb:
March 2003 - an inside source leaks a partial list of HLS's recent customers to activists. Toxweb is listed as having contracted in 2001 and 2002.
April 2003 - activists begin targeting Toxweb:
April 25 - Toxweb office disruption and CEO home demo. Read the write up here: http://www.shacamerica.net/news_apr25a_03.htm
May 5 - Toxweb CEO gets a late night wake up call. Read the write up here: http://www.shacamerica.net/news_may5_03.htm
May 20 - paint attack on a Toxweb employee's home. Read the write up here: http://www.shacamerica.net/news_may20b_03.htm
May 24 - Home Demo Week is kicked off with Toxweb employee home demos Read the write up here: http://www.shacamerica.net/news_may25_03.htm
May 28 - Toxweb cuts ties with HLS! Read the statement: http://www.shacamerica.net/news_may29_03.htm
